Transaction 2ffd452447e92f4b76b87243923bdb9558fd003a62a64fece34ddc2e94d27e66

3 Input
1 Outputs
  • 2ffd452447e92f4b76b87243923bdb9558fd003a62a64fece34ddc2e94d27e66:0
  • value  1384683
    address  1HmVs2gt642vEN6FMFhnB2yApjs4SkA5TQ